The Future of Smart Helmets for Contact Sports Safety

Contact sports such as football, hockey, and rugby have always carried a risk of head injuries. As technology advances, smart helmets are emerging as a promising solution to enhance player safety and reduce the severity of concussions and other traumatic brain injuries.

What Are Smart Helmets?

Smart helmets are equipped with sensors and embedded technology that monitor impacts and provide real-time data. These helmets can detect the force and location of hits, helping coaches and medical staff assess injuries more accurately and quickly.

Current Innovations in Smart Helmet Technology

  • Impact sensors: Measure the force of collisions to identify potentially dangerous hits.
  • Data connectivity: Transmit impact data wirelessly to medical teams or training staff.
  • Player tracking: Monitor player movements and head positions during gameplay.
  • Real-time alerts: Notify coaches when a player sustains a significant impact.

The Future of Smart Helmets

Looking ahead, smart helmets are expected to become more sophisticated with enhanced sensors, AI-powered impact analysis, and improved comfort. These advancements could allow for:

  • Personalized safety profiles: Tailoring helmet responses based on individual player history.
  • Predictive analytics: Using data trends to predict injury risks before they happen.
  • Enhanced durability and comfort: Making helmets less intrusive and more wearable for extended periods.
  • Integration with medical records: Facilitating immediate medical response and long-term injury tracking.

Challenges and Considerations

Despite the promising potential, there are challenges to overcome. These include ensuring data privacy, reducing costs for widespread adoption, and making the technology durable enough to withstand the rigors of contact sports. Additionally, educating players and coaches about interpreting impact data is crucial for effective use.
